- The distance between Greensboro, Al, Usa and Churchill, Manitoba, Canada is approximately 2,897 km or 1,800 mi.
- To reach Greensboro, Al in this distance one would set out from Churchill, Manitoba bearing 168.4°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Greensboro, Al bearing 172.8° or S .
- Greensboro, Al has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Churchill, Manitoba has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Greensboro, Al is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Churchill, Manitoba is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 24.9 °C (44.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.5 °C (33.3°F) less in Greensboro, Al.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1029.8 mm (40.5 in) more which is equivalent to 1029.8 l/m² (25.27 US gal/ft²) or 10,298,000 l/ha (1,100,925 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.7° higher in Greensboro, Al than in Churchill, Manitoba.
